There's a discrepancy between this month's Canadian LTD & YTD compared to lastmonth's.

LTD: June / July = Difference

Wii: 986,200 / 1,060,000 = 73,800
360: 840, 700 / 870,000 = 29,300
PS3: 487,600 / 520,000 = 32,400

YTD: June / July = Difference

Wii: 318,000 / 376,000 = 58,000
PS3: 170,500 / 200,000 = 29,500
360: 129,000 / 154,000 = 25,000

PS3 & 360 can be explained by YTD being rounded off to 1k and LTD being rounded off to 10k, but it can't Wii difference. I'm going to use the YTD data as it's more accurate, but there seems to be a mistake in either this month's or last month's data. It's not a significant difference, but hopefully future numbers will show us where the mistake lies. If NPD had adjusted their numbers it should have affected the both LTD & YTD figures.
